Doctor speaks about the cancer of the uterus. He uses a graphic to identify the uterus or womb, a monthly source of bleeding, i.e. menstruation. Also identifies the fallopian tubes, ovaries, vagina, and cervix, also known as the neck of the uterus.

Doctors says that 75% of cancers of the uterus occur in the cervix. Says that cancer of the sexual organs is the second most common cancer among women. About 23,000 women each year die from this disease alone, says the doctor. Thinks these deaths are tragic and need not occur.
